Situated in Old Silk Mill on the banks of the River Loddon and offered to the market with no onward chain is this one-bedroom second-floor apartment for the over 55's with views of the nature reserve.
Old Silk Mill offers independent living for over 55's with a very active social scene if desired, with the reassurance of an In-House Manager and lift to all floors.
Located within a short walk to the village amenities including supermarkets, chemists, cafes, library and Twyford Station on the Elizabeth Line. There is also a bus stop just outside of Old Silk Mill.
The apartment has accommodation comprising of an entrance hallway, lounge with double aspect windows, a spacious kitchen fitted with eye and base level units with space for a small dining table, a double bedroom with built-in wardrobes and a good sized bathroom with a bathtub and an overhead shower.
Outside there are well-maintained communal grounds and ample residents/visitor parking (new restrictions apply). Residents also benefit from access to a laundry room.
There is also a guest suite for family and friends on the ground. This will need to be booked with the Manager and is available at a low cost.
Lease details: 125 years from 1999
Service Charge: £913.77 per quarter Includes water and laundry..
Ground Rent: £340.00pa approx.
Council Tax Band: C
Water: Mains Connected
Heating: Electric
Electricity: Mains Connected
Sewerage: Mains Connected
